D. Closure requirements. The responsible party must take the following action for any major or minor release containing liquids.
(1) The responsible party must test the remediated areas for contamination with representative five-point composite samples from the walls and base, and individual grab samples from any wet or discolored areas. The samples must be analyzed for the constituents listed in Table I of 19.15.29.12 NMAC or constituents from other applicable remediation standards.
E. Closure reporting. The responsible party must take the following action for any major or minor release containing liquids.
(1) The responsible party must submit to the division a closure report on form C-141, including required attachments, to document all closure activities including sampling results and the details on any backfilling, capping or covering, where applicable. The responsible party must certify that all information in the closure report and attachments is correct and that the responsible party has complied with all applicable closure requirements and conditions specified in division rules or directives. The responsible party must submit closure report along with form C-141 to the division within 90 days of the remediation plan approval. (2) The division district office has 60 days to review and approve or deny the closure report. If 60 days have lapsed without response from the division, then the report is deemed denied. If the report is affirmatively denied, the division shall provide a written summary of deficiencies on which the decision is based. If the responsible party disagrees with denial of the closure report, it may consult with the division or file an application for hearing pursuant to 19.15.4 NMAC within 30 days of the denial.
Table I Closure Criteria for Soils Impacted by a Release Minimum depth below any point within the horizontal boundary of the release to ground water less than 10,000 mg/l TDS Constituent Method* Limit** < 50 feet Chloride*** EPA 300.0 or SM4500 Cl B 600 mg/kg TPH (GRO+DRO+MRO) EPA SW-846 Method 8015M 100 mg/kg BTEX EPA SW-846 Method 8021B or 8260B 50 mg/kg Benzene EPA SW-846 Method 8021B or 8260B 10 mg/kg 51 feet-100 feet Chloride*** EPA 300.0 or SM4500 Cl B 10,000 mg/kg TPH (GRO+DRO+MRO) EPA SW-846 Method 8015M 2,500 mg/kg GRO+DRO EPA SW-846 Method 8015M 1,000 mg/kg BTEX EPA SW-846 Method 8021B or 8260B 50 mg/kg Benzene EPA SW-846 Method 8021B or 8260B 10 mg/kg >100 feet Chloride*** EPA 300.0 or SM4500 Cl B 20,000 mg/kg TPH (GRO+DRO+MRO) EPA SW-846 Method 8015M 2,500 mg/kg GRO+DRO EPA SW-846 Method 8015M 1,000 mg/kg BTEX EPA SW-846 Method 8021B or 8260B 50 mg/kg Benzene EPA SW-846 Method 8021B or 8260B 10 mg/kg

*Or other test methods approved by the division.
**Numerical limits or natural background level, whichever is greater.
***This applies to releases of produced water or other fluids, which may contain chloride.
